The Sposato Chronicles Part Two: Pasta with a Side of Mayhem
Description:
Set in the city of Pisa in 1351 (67 years after our last game). The city is in decline after losing a war and paying high tribute to Genoa. The supernaturals have lain low since the war but that all changes this year. The vampires must defend their city against tyrranical elders, abominations, the Anarch Revolt, demons and the Catholic Church. The True Fae are fighting off banality and the shattering and the Garou are now replaced by the Ratkin. NOTE: This is a multi-night LARP. You need to purchase a ticket for each night you wish to participate in, but you are not required to play in all three.

Every summer Wicked Jerry's Traveling Show eases back onto the road. Legend has it that the first gig was in '46 in an empty farmer's field somewhere in Pennsylvania. An ex-bomber pilot named Jerry Kendle sunk all the money he'd stashed away while overseas into a Packard and a small Creole band out of Louisiana. All good things end up tainted. A murder, a mystery, and a mandolin all now haunt the fortunes of the show that has rolled into legend.
